Simplifying 45 + 5y = x Solving 45 + 5y = x Solving for variable 'y'. Move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-45' to each side of the equation. 45 + -45 + 5y = -45 + x Combine like terms: 45 + -45 = 0 0 + 5y = -45 + x 5y = -45 + x Divide each side by '5'. y = -9 + 0.2x Simplifying y = -9 + 0.2x
